Recent mass layoffs in both the U.S. government and private sector have led many to seek new employment. However, finding a role that fits your skills and experience can be stressful.

Applicants typically have a few options when job searching:

  • Wait for a job posting close to their previous role.
  • Lean on connections in your industry to find a new role.
  • Pivot careers to an adjacent role or something new altogether.

According to the Harvard Business Review, “The accelerated pace of technological change and, most recently, the advent of AI are reshaping jobs and organizations in ways that call for constant career reinvention.”

Here’s what to consider in 2025 if you’re thinking about changing careers.

Job market

Fewer opportunities might be available in your field than just a few years ago. To learn why, applicants can turn to the U.S. labor report for answers. It provides a detailed employment breakdown by geographic location and can give a better idea of the overall market’s health.
